HUMAN RIGHTS ACT 2004 - SECT 14

Freedom of thought, conscience, religion and belief

    (1)     Everyone has the right to freedom of thought, conscience and religion. This right includes—

        (a)     the freedom to have or to adopt a religion or belief of their choice; and

        (b)     the freedom to demonstrate their religion or belief in worship, observance, practice and teaching, either individually or as part of a community and whether in public or private.

    (2)     No-one may be coerced in a way that would limit their freedom to have or adopt a religion or belief in worship, observance, practice or teaching.
